Peugeot 308 automatic gearbox issue
Summary of the thread
A 2023 Peugeot 308 with an electric engine is experiencing issues with the automatic gearbox, including gear slipping, grinding noises, and slow paddle shifters. The gearbox is stuck in emergency mode, and the error memory is full of warnings, suggesting a defective transmission control unit (TCU). After reading the error codes, it was confirmed that the TCU was the problem, leading to its replacement, which resolved the issue.
